§ 58921 Marketing Order Assessment Rules

Key Takeaways

  • •Farmers have to pay fees to help cover the costs of making and enforcing rules about selling their crops.
  • •If the rules include ads or sales promotions, farmers also pay for those.
  • •But if you grow green ripe olives, you don’t have to pay for ads or promotions—only your share of the basic costs.

Example

A group of orange farmers has rules about how they sell their oranges. The government helps make and enforce these rules.

The farmers have to pay fees to cover the cost of making these rules and making sure everyone follows them. If the rules include ads to sell more oranges, the farmers also pay for those ads. But if you’re a green olive farmer, you only pay for the basic rule costs, not the ads.

§ 58921 Marketing Order Assessment Rules

Except as otherwise provided in Section 58926, each marketing order which is issued pursuant to this chapter shall provide for the levying and collection of assessments in sufficient amounts to defray the necessary expenses which are incurred by the director in the formulation, issuance, administration, and enforcement of the marketing order. If the marketing order authorizes the carrying out of advertising and sales promotion plans, it shall also provide for the levying and collection of assessments in sufficient amounts to defray the expenses of such activities. No assessment for advertising or sales promotion activities shall, however, be levied under any marketing order with respect to the marketing and handling of green ripe olives except that green ripe olives may be assessed for their proportionate share of administrative costs. (Enacted by Stats. 1967, Ch. 15.)
